Ingredients
Scale
- 2 large sweet potatoes
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on cornstarch
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
- 1 tablespoon nutritional yeast (optional)
- Fresh herbs (optional)
Instructions
- Select and wash the sweet potatoes, then peel them.
- Cut the sweet potatoes into uniform fries, about 1/4 inch thick.
- Toss the fries in a bowl with olive oil to coat them evenly.
- Add the spice mix to the fries and toss again to ensure they are well coated.
- Spread the fries in a single layer on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Bake in a preheated oven at 425°F (220°C) for 25-30 minutes, flipping halfway through.
Notes
- Soak the fries in cold water for 30 minutes before baking for extra crispiness.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days.
- Reheat in the oven to regain crispiness.
- Experiment with different spices and toppings for variety.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 25-30 minutes
